Rule body yaml

title: Application Terminated Via Wmic.EXE
id: 49d9671b-0a0a-4c09-8280-d215bfd30662
related:
    - id: 847d5ff3-8a31-4737-a970-aeae8fe21765 # Uninstall Security Products
      type: derived
status: test
description: Detects calls to the "terminate" function via wmic in order to kill an application
references:
    - https://cyble.com/blog/lockfile-ransomware-using-proxyshell-attack-to-deploy-ransomware/
    - https://www.bitdefender.com/files/News/CaseStudies/study/377/Bitdefender-Whitepaper-WMI-creat4871-en-EN-GenericUse.pdf
author: Nasreddine Bencherchali (Nextron Systems)
date: 2023-09-11
tags:
    - attack.execution
    - attack.t1047
logsource:
    category: process_creation
    product: windows
detection:
    selection_img:
        - Image|endswith: '\WMIC.exe'
        - OriginalFileName: 'wmic.exe'
    selection_cli:
        CommandLine|contains|all:
            - 'call'
            - 'terminate'
    condition: all of selection_*
falsepositives:
    - Unknown
level: medium
